Net income for the quarter was $2.2 million, or $.33 per share, compared with earnings of $1.8 million, or $.28 per share for 1994, a per share increase of 18%. For the nine months ended Sept. 30, 1995, the company's operating revenues were $153.3 million compared to operating revenues of $119.8 million for the same nine months of 1994. This was an increase of 28%. Net income for the nine months ended Sept. 30, 1995, was $6.2 million, or $.93 per share, compared with earnings of $4.8 million, or $.76 per share for the same nine months for 1994, a per share increase of 22%. "We are pleased with the quarter's and the year-to-date's performance," said Ken Melkus, HealthWise's chairman and chief executive officer. Melkus added, "While we experience strong growth and profitability, we continue to commit substantial resources to developing and marketing new products and to absorbing the start-up Start-up The earliest stage of a new business venture. losses of our new HMOs." HealthWise completed the third quarter with approximately 139,000 members compared with 106,000 for the comparable quarter ended in 1994, or 31% growth. Melkus added, "While competitive efforts continue to grow, we are enthusiastic about the future of managed care and are positioning the company to take advantage of these opportunities.
